Brine solutions, such as calcium chloride (CaCl₂) and sodium chloride (NaCl), are valued in refrigeration and freezing applications for their excellent thermal conductivity and low-temperature fluidity. However, chloride ions and dissolved oxygen in brine can cause severe corrosion in metal equipment, leading to damage, reduced efficiency, and even system failure.
